Patent number: 7938173Abstract: Fixed to the peripheral wall of a header 2 of a unit-type heat exchanger 1 is a receiver connecting block 6 having channels 31, 32 for causing the interior of the header 2 to communicate with the interior of a liquid receiver 7 therethrough. The block 6 and the liquid receiver 7 have respective fixing portions 32, 36 and respective contact faces 22a, 36a each provided on the fixing portion. The outer peripheral surfaces of the fixing portions 22, 36 have respective contours of the same shape and the same size. The liquid receiver 7 is fixed to the block 6 with the contact faces 22a, 36a of the fixing portions 22, 36 in intimate contact with each other. A tubular seal member 42 having rubber elasticity is liquid-tightly fitted around the fixing portions 22, 36. The seal member 42 has an inner shape smaller than the contours of the outer peripheral surfaces of the fixing portions 22, 36 and is fitted as elastically deformed around the fixing portions 22, 36.Type: GrantFiled: May 10, 2005Date of Patent: May 10, 2011Assignee: Showa Denko K.K.Inventors: Yoshihiko Seno, Osamu Kamoshida, Takayuki Yasutake

Patent number: 5720341Abstract: A duplex heat exchanger of the so-called stacked type has in principle a plurality of plate-shaped tubular elements (1) which are stacked side by side or one on another and a plurality of fins (2) each intervening between the adjacent tubular elements. Each tubular element is composed of flat tubular segments (3a, 4a) separated from each other and each communicating with one of bulged header portions (3b, 4b) of the tubular element, so that flow paths (3, 4) for heat exchanging media are formed through each tubular element. Two or more unit heat exchangers (X, Y) are defined integral with each other within the duplex heat exchanger, since the adjacent tubular elements (1) communicate with each other through the header portions (3b, 4b).Type: GrantFiled: November 12, 1996Date of Patent: February 24, 1998Assignee: Showa Aluminum CorporationInventors: Mikio Watanabe, Takayuki Yasutake, Shoichi Watanabe, Yuji Hasegawa

Patent number: 5025855Abstract: A condenser apparatus includes a pair of headers provided in parallel with each other; a plurality of tubular elements whose opposite ends are connected to the headers; and fins provided in the air paths between one tube and the next. Each of the headers is made of a cylindrical pipe of aluminum. At least one of the headers is internally divided by a partition into at least two groups of coolant passageways, thus enabling the flow of coolant to make at least one U-turn in the header. The partition extends into the header through a slit in the header. Each of the tubular elements is made of a flat hollow tube of aluminum. The opposite ends of the tubular elements are inserted into slits produced in the headers so that they are liquid-tightly secured.Type: GrantFiled: April 16, 1990Date of Patent: June 25, 1991Assignee: Showa Aluminum Kabushiki KaishaInventors: Ryoichi Hoshino, Hironaka Sasaki, Takayuki Yasutake

Patent number: 4729428Abstract: A heat exchanger of the plate fin type having first fluid channels and second fluid channels arranged alternately and each separated from the adjacent channel by a flat metal plate. At least one of the first fluid channel and the second fluid channel is formed by a pair of adjacent flat metal plates and a spacer interposed between the flat plates. The spacer comprises a pair of side walls each joined to and interconnecting a pair of opposed edges of the two flat plates at each side thereof, a connecting wall interconnecting the two side walls, and fins provided on the connecting wall at an angle therewith and joined at their forward ends to the flat plate, the fins extending in parallel with the direction of flow of fluid through the fluid channel. The heat exchanger is fabricated by arranging plate plates, spacers, fins and spacer bars in layers and joining the parts together by brazing at the same time.Type: GrantFiled: June 27, 1986Date of Patent: March 8, 1988Assignee: Showa Aluminum CorporationInventors: Takayuki Yasutake, Tetsuo Shibata
